The Rise of Voice Assistants in Sound Branding

Voice assistants have moved from novelty to necessity. Over 50% of U.S. adults use voice assistants daily, with smart speakers present in more than 35% of households. This ubiquity means brands now have a direct audio channel to their customers—one that is hands-free, always on, and inherently personal.

From Audio Logos to Voice‑Activated Experiences

Traditional sound branding relied on one-way audio: a jingle, a sonic logo, or a brand song broadcast to a passive audience. Voice assistants flip that model by enabling two-way interaction. A customer can say “Alexa, order my favorite coffee” or “Hey Google, what’s the daily special?”—and the brand’s response is part of its auditory identity. These voice‑activated experiences require a deliberate sound strategy that goes beyond a logo to include tone of voice, choice of accent, background audio, and even silence. For instance, the banking app Capital One uses a consistent warm and professional voice across its Alexa skill and mobile app, ensuring that every interaction reinforces trust and reliability.

Designing a Voice‑First Brand Persona

When a brand “speaks” through a voice assistant, its personality must be consistent across all touchpoints. A luxury brand might choose a warm, measured female voice with a slight accent, while a youthful tech brand might opt for an energetic, neutral assistant. The way the voice pronounces the brand name, handles errors, or transitions between tasks all contribute to the overall brand impression. Companies like Mastercard have invested heavily in sonic identity guidelines that cover voice interactions, ensuring that every sonic burst or voice prompt aligns with their brand values. Mastercard’s Sonic Identity now includes specific rules for pitch, tempo, and silence duration across voice-enabled devices.

Leveraging AI for Personalized Sound Experiences

Where voice assistants provide the interface, AI provides the intelligence. AI‑powered sound branding uses machine learning to analyze user behavior, environmental context, and even emotional state to adjust audio elements in real time. This personalization makes every interaction feel bespoke, which in turn boosts brand recall and loyalty.

Adaptive Audio and Dynamic Jingles

Instead of a static sonic logo, brands can now deploy adaptive jingles that change tempo, instrumentation, or key depending on the listener’s mood (inferred from voice tone) or the time of day. A coffee brand could play a bright, upbeat melody in the morning and a mellow, acoustic version in the evening. Coca-Cola experimented with an AI-generated jingle that adjusted its rhythm based on the listener’s heart rate via a connected wearable—a limited but revealing test of adaptive audio. Tools like Adobe Audition now incorporate generative AI features that produce dozens of variations of a sonic logo, each tailored to different contexts while maintaining core identity.

Real‑Time Sentiment Adaptation

Advanced AI models analyze the emotional content of a user’s voice command—detecting frustration, excitement, or neutrality—and adjust the brand response accordingly. If a customer sounds annoyed, the brand voice becomes softer, slower, and more empathetic. If cheerful, the response might include a playful sound effect. This level of responsiveness was impossible before AI. A case study from Nuance Communications showed that sentiment-aware voice responses reduced customer frustration by 35% in call center scenarios. Brands adopting this for voice assistants can expect similar gains in satisfaction.

Data‑Driven Sound Design

AI also enables brands to mine customer interaction data for insights. Which audio cues prompt the most engagement? Which voice tones lead to higher conversion rates? By feeding this data back into the sound design process, brands continuously refine their audio identity. Spotify uses similar principles to personalize playlists, but brands can apply the same logic to sound branding: the more you know about your audience’s audio preferences, the more effectively you can communicate. A Forrester report found that brands using data-driven audio adjustments saw a 28% increase in repeat voice interactions over six months.

Strategies for Incorporating Voice and AI in Sound Branding

Successful integration requires a structured approach. Below are key strategies with detailed guidance.

Develop Voice‑Enabled Content

Create branded skills or actions for major voice platforms. A food brand might build a “Recipe Finder” skill that uses the brand’s voice to guide users through a recipe, playing a branded sound at each step. These voice‑activated experiences should be designed with the same care as a mobile app. Use A/B testing to compare voice personas and sound effects. Prioritize utility: the best voice content is genuinely helpful, not just promotional. For example, Domino’s “Easy Order” skill lets customers reorder their favorite pizza with a single command, reinforced by a short, recognizable sonic cue.

Use AI for Audience Segmentation

AI can segment listeners not just by demographics but by acoustic preferences. Some listeners respond better to high‑pitched tones, others to low, resonant voices. Use machine learning models trained on past interaction data to predict which sonic elements resonate with each segment, then serve the appropriate audio variant automatically. This ensures a brand appeals to multiple personas without losing consistency. Consider building a “sonic persona” for each major segment—similar to how Netflix profiles learn viewing tastes.

Maintain Brand Consistency Across All Audio Channels

With multiple voice assistants, smart speakers, and in‑car systems, maintaining a unified sound is challenging. Create a comprehensive sonic brand guide that specifies voice characteristics (pitch, speed, accent), background soundscapes, jingle structure, and even silence management. This guide should be version‑controlled and shared with every agency or developer working on voice projects. Tools like Audiobranding offer platforms to manage and distribute audio assets across channels. Also, document platform-specific quirks—for instance, Alexa’s audio compression is different from Google Assistant’s.

Test, Measure, and Optimize Continuously

Voice and AI sound branding is not a set‑and‑forget effort. Use analytics to monitor how users interact with your audio content. Track metrics like completion rate (did the user stay for the full sonic logo?), sentiment via voice tone analysis post‑interaction, and conversion. Run controlled experiments: change one audio element at a time and measure impact. Iterate based on data, not just intuition. A/B testing a different voice pace can shift user spend by 15% in some retail voice apps, according to internal studies from SoundHound.

Challenges and Considerations

Despite the promise, voice‑AI sound branding comes with hurdles that brands must address proactively.

Privacy and Data Security

Voice data is highly personal. Collecting, storing, and analyzing it requires transparent consent and robust security. Regulations like GDPR and CCPA impose strict rules on voice recordings. Brands should anonymize data, avoid storing raw audio longer than necessary, and give users control over their voice profiles. Trust is paramount—any breach can permanently damage brand perception. The GDPR data minimization principle applies directly to voice data collection.

Voice Fatigue and Over‑Personalization

Consumers can grow tired of constant audio interruptions. Over‑customization may also feel intrusive or creepy. The goal is personalization without invasion. Use context and opt‑in triggers—for example, after a user asks for an update—rather than pushing unsolicited audio. Allow users to adjust their sound preferences, including the ability to disable branded audio if desired. A 2024 ACSI survey found that 44% of consumers dislike branded audio that plays without context.

Technical Consistency Across Platforms

Each voice assistant platform—Alexa, Google Assistant, Siri, Bixby, Cortana—has its own audio capabilities and limitations. A sound that works perfectly on Alexa may distort on Siri. Brands must test on all target platforms and create platform‑specific variations of their audio assets. Using a universal sound design framework (e.g., all files at 44.1kHz, 16‑bit, mono) helps reduce compatibility issues. Also, account for varying latency: Google Assistant often responds faster than Alexa, so jingle timing must be adjusted to avoid cutoffs.

Measuring ROI and KPIs in Voice-AI Sound Branding

Quantifying the return on investment for sound branding can be elusive, but with voice and AI, specific metrics become trackable.

Engagement Metrics

Track skill or action invocation rates, session duration, and completion rates for multi-step voice flows. A high drop-off rate after a sound cue may indicate the audio is jarring or unappealing. Use voice analytics platforms like Voxable or Dashbot to monitor these.

Brand Recall and Sentiment

Conduct surveys before and after voice skill launches. Measure aided and unaided recall of the brand’s sonic logo. Also analyze post-interaction sentiment via voice tone analysis: a more positive tone after hearing a branded sound is a good sign.

Conversion and Lift

If the voice skill enables purchases or lead generation, track conversion rates against an audio-off control group. For example, Starbucks found that users who heard their branded order confirmation sound were 12% more likely to use the skill again within a week compared to those who heard a generic tone.

Attribution Modeling

Use cross-channel attribution to see if voice interactions influence later website visits or in-store purchases. AI can correlate voice data with CRM records to show the incremental value of sound branding.
